Epilog fusion m2 40

Dual source fiber and CO2 laser cutter and engraver.

Hardware:

  • Working volume: 40" x 28" x 13.25"

  • Resolution: user controlled from 75 to 1200 DPI

  • Variable laser speed and power

  • Rotisserie attachment available for rotational engraving

  • 75W CO2 laser

  • 50W fiber laser

LittleMachineShop 5500 Bench Mill

Powerful metalworking bench mill.

Hardware

  • 750 watt (1 hp) brushless DC variable speed drive

  • No gears in spindle drive

  • R8 spindle and drill chuck

  • Tapping mode for reversing taps out

  • 23.4" x 5.5" table

  • Accurate to 0.0004"

Dual grit 6" bench grinder.

Hardware

  • 6" wheel diameter

  • 36 and 60 grit wheels

  • Built in eye shields, spark deflectors, and tool rests

  • Motor runs at 3,450 rpm with no load

  • 12-1/2" distance between wheels

  • 5/8 HP induction motor

A combination belt sander and disc sander.

Hardware

  • 6" disc diameter

  • 4" x 36" belt

  • Belt tilts up to 90° for horizontal or vertical sanding

  • Miter gauge included for disc sander for sanding angled edges

  • Disc motor runs at 3450 rpm with no load

  • Belt runs at 1900 sfm with no load

  • 1/2 HP motor
